From fc80296015614c2e5382597d76a7483f04a22eac Mon Sep 17 00:00:00 2001 From: Robert Kaussow Date: Tue, 23 Jan 2024 09:52:10 +0100 Subject: [PATCH] chore: add schedule for high-freq digest updates --- base.json | 4 ++-- docker.json | 1 + golang.json | 8 ++++---- 3 files changed, 7 insertions(+), 6 deletions(-) diff --git a/base.json b/base.json index 401559c..ceed3e8 100644 --- a/base.json +++ b/base.json @@ -34,12 +34,12 @@ }, { "description": "Automerge dev dependencies", + "extends": ["schedule:weekly"], "groupName": "devDeps non-major", "matchDepTypes": ["devDependencies", "dev-dependencies", "dev"], "matchUpdateTypes": ["pin", "digest", "patch", "minor"], "automerge": true, - "automergeType": "branch", - "extends": ["schedule:weekly"] + "automergeType": "branch" } ], "customManagers": [ diff --git a/docker.json b/docker.json index 2ddb719..5dbe2e3 100644 --- a/docker.json +++ b/docker.json @@ -12,6 +12,7 @@ }, { "description": "Automerge digest updates (usually security patches)", + "extends": ["schedule:daily"], "groupName": "docker digests", "matchDatasources": ["docker"], "matchPackagePatterns": [ diff --git a/golang.json b/golang.json index 6404c29..57eaf0f 100644 --- a/golang.json +++ b/golang.json @@ -11,21 +11,21 @@ "packageRules": [ { "description": "Automerge golang dev dependencies", + "extends": ["schedule:weekly"], "groupName": "golang devDeps non-major", "matchDatasources": ["github-releases"], "matchPackageNames": ["mvdan/gofumpt", "golangci/golangci-lint"], "matchUpdateTypes": ["pin", "digest", "patch", "minor"], "automerge": true, - "automergeType": "branch", - "extends": ["schedule:weekly"] + "automergeType": "branch" }, { "description": "Schedule high frequency packages", + "extends": ["schedule:weekly"], "groupName": "golang highFeq non-major", "matchDatasources": ["go"], "matchPackagePatterns": ["urfave/cli"], - "matchUpdateTypes": ["pin", "digest", "patch", "minor"], - "extends": ["schedule:weekly"] + "matchUpdateTypes": ["pin", "digest", "patch", "minor"] } ] }